- Description
- This is a Sources Sought. A contract may not result. The project objective is to improve the aerodynamic shape of the heavy-class motor vehicles. The process of shape designing requires the knowledge of complex three-dimensional flow field around the vehicle which is obtained by means of Particle Image Velocimetry and thermal imaging. A wind tunnel with these diagnostics is sought for a 1/8th scale heavy vehicle model such that the Reynolds number is greater than 2 million, therefore, the wind tunnel flow speed must exceed 200 miles-per-hour. The test object will be provided. The deliverable is a presentation, in-person, to Lawrence-Livermore National Laboratory and a written report of the test results. The desired testing date is to begin September 7, 2015, and take up to four weeks. A test plan is enclosed and available at the FedConnect website, in the upper-right corner of this notice.
